'' courses

All '' courses:

  1. How to Create an Email Newsletter in MailChimp

    How to Create an Email Newsletter in MailChimp

    Course Beginner

    In this course, you'll learn to create a great-looking email newsletter with MailChimp. Email is still one of the best ways to engage an audience. Whether...

  2. Connect a Database to Your Python Application

    Connect a Database to Your Python Application

    Course Intermediate

    Most apps will need a database for the back-end, but the specific database you choose shouldn't make much of a difference to your app's architecture. With...

  3. Breaking the Grid With CSS Grid Layout

    Breaking the Grid With CSS Grid Layout

    Course Intermediate

    Broken grid layouts (layouts that don’t fit within traditional grid-based layouts) are not only becoming more popular, but they are also easier to achieve...

  4. Practical CSS: Desktop to Mobile Navigation Patterns

    Practical CSS: Desktop to Mobile Navigation Patterns

    Course Beginner

    Creating a website navigation that looks the same on every screen is not really possible. Owing to the smaller screen size, mobile devices often require a...

  5. 6 Handy CSS3 Animation Projects

    6 Handy CSS3 Animation Projects

    Course Beginner

    Using motion in your web project and adding an extra degree of interactivity can really improve the user experience. In this short course you’ll build six...

  6. Convert a jQuery App to Vue.js

    Convert a jQuery App to Vue.js

    Course Intermediate

    Front-end web frameworks have taken component-based development and kicked it into high gear. Vue.js is one of the newest and most popular frameworks and is...

  7. 10 Tips to Master Adobe Photoshop Brushes

    10 Tips to Master Adobe Photoshop Brushes

    Course Beginner

    Mastering the Brush Tool is an essential skill every designer should learn. In this course, 10 Tips to Master Adobe Photoshop Brushes, you'll learn...

  8. Angular Fundamentals

    Angular Fundamentals

    Course Intermediate

    When it was first released, Angular turned the world of front-end development upside down. It was one of the first modern JavaScript frameworks, and the...

  9. Up and Running With Cinema 4D

    Up and Running With Cinema 4D

    Course Beginner

    This is a course for artists and designers who are completely new to 3D and are ready to learn the foundational skills that Cinema 4D provides. You'll learn...

  10. Build a Classic Five-Page Website

    Build a Classic Five-Page Website

    Course Beginner

    The "five-page static website” is the bread and butter of web design. Even though it doesn’t have the ubiquitous presence online it once did, only if you are...

  11. Four Bootstrap 4 Projects

    Four Bootstrap 4 Projects

    Course Intermediate

    In this project-based course, you will learn how to customize Bootstrap 4 as you create four practical web projects using the most recent version of the...

  12. A Practical Approach to Working With Vue.js and APIs

    A Practical Approach to Working With Vue.js and APIs

    Course Intermediate

    In this course, you’ll make practical use of the Vue.js framework. In five lessons you’ll learn to use an API to pull in data that you will then display...